Фундамент HTML и CSS для стартующих
Разработка сайтов стартует с освоения двух важнейших инструментов. HTML отвечает за организацию и содержимое веб-страниц. CSS регулирует зрительным дизайном блоков.
Разработчики используют HTML для расположения текста, изображений, ссылок и других компонентов. CSS позволяет назначать оттенки, шрифты, размеры и размещение контейнеров. Эти языки функционируют совместно и дополняют друг друга.
Постижение 7к casino зеркало предоставляет путь к профессии веб-разработчика. Знание базовых основ способствует создавать действующие и эстетичные порталы. Начинающие специалисты могут скоро получить практические навыки и использовать их в действующих задачах.
Что такое HTML и зачем он нужен веб-ресурсу
HTML интерпретируется как HyperText Markup Language. Язык разметки устанавливает организацию веб-документов и структурирует содержимое страниц. Браузеры обрабатывают HTML-код и отображают контент в ясном для посетителей формате.
Каждый компонент веб-страницы определяется специфическими директивами. Титулы, абзацы, перечни, таблицы и формы генерируются с посредством тегов. Метки представляют собой команды, помещённые в угловые скобки. Браузер читает эти команды и строит графическое отображение контента.
Без HTML нельзя создать 7К казино любого вида. Язык разметки является базой для всех веб-ресурсов. Поисковые системы исследуют HTML-структуру для индексации веб-страниц. Корректная структура усиливает места веб-ресурса в результатах поиска.
HTML регулярно эволюционирует и получает новые функции. Актуальная версия HTML5 обеспечивает видео, аудио и динамические элементы. Специалисты могут внедрять медийный содержимое без внешних модулей. Семантические элементы помогают казино 7к лучше понимать роль разнообразных элементов веб-страницы.
Базовые теги и архитектура веб-страницы
Любой HTML-документ содержит чёткую иерархическую структуру. Корневой элемент html вмещает всё содержимое страницы. Внутри находятся два ключевых раздела: head и body.
Секция head сохраняет вспомогательную сведения о файле. Здесь определяется заголовок веб-страницы, присоединяются стили и скрипты. Посетители не воспринимают контент этого элемента прямо. Секция body включает весь доступный содержимое.
Для структурирования контента используются разные метки:
- h1-h6 формируют названия разных степеней
- p формирует текстовые параграфы
- a генерирует гиперссылки на прочие веб-страницы
- img встраивает графику в страницу
- ul и ol создают маркированные и нумерованные списки
- table структурирует данные в табличном виде
Семантические элементы превращают структуру более понятной. Компонент header определяет верхнюю часть портала. Элемент nav объединяет навигационные ссылки. Блок main включает главное контент страницы. Footer размещается в нижней зоне и включает контактную информацию.
Корректная архитектура страницы значима для доступности. Приложения чтения с экрана применяют 7k casino для навигации по сайту. Разумная компоновка компонентов упрощает понимание информации всеми типами пользователей. Соответствующий код функционирует исправно во всех современных обозревателях.
Как CSS отвечает за внешний облик сайта
CSS расшифровывается как Cascading Style Sheets. Каскадные таблицы стилей задают зрительное оформление HTML-элементов. Инструмент отделяет оформление от структуры документа.
Без стилей все сайты выглядят монотонно. Браузер выводит текст чёрным тоном на белом фоне. Названия получают базовые величины. CSS даёт возможность изменить каждый элемент визуального облика.
Стили можно подключить тремя методами. Отдельный файл присоединяется с HTML-документом через метку link. Внутренние стили помещаются в метке style. Inline стили прописываются в атрибуте элемента.
Каскадность подразумевает приоритет действия директив. Встроенные стили имеют наивысший приоритет. Внутренние стили перекрывают внешние. Браузер использует самое специфичное директиву к каждому компоненту.
CSS регулирует всеми графическими свойствами. Разработчики определяют оттенки заднего плана и текста. Стили модифицируют размеры, интервалы и границы контейнеров. Актуальный 7К казино применяет анимации и переходы для формирования динамических результатов.
Селекторы, параметры и параметры в CSS
Правило CSS формируется из трёх частей. Селектор обозначает тег для стилизования. Параметр устанавливает особенность стилизации. Значение задаёт конкретный показатель.
Селекторы определяют элементы по разным критериям. Селектор элемента назначает стили ко всем элементам конкретного вида. Селектор класса взаимодействует с параметром class. Селектор идентификатора выбирает уникальный компонент по свойству id.
Составные селекторы генерируют более конкретные директивы. Селектор потомка выбирает внутренние элементы. Селектор дочернего элемента работает только с непосредственными наследниками. Псевдоклассы назначают стили при конкретных состояниях.
Свойства задают различные аспекты оформления. Атрибуты color и background-color управляют цветовой схемой. Атрибуты width и height устанавливают габариты. Свойства margin и padding управляют интервалы.
Параметры прописываются в разнообразных видах. Цвета определяются в шестнадцатеричном формате, RGB или наименованиями. Габариты определяются в пикселях, процентах или пропорциональных величинах. Грамотное применение селекторов помогает казино 7к результативно регулировать стилизацией совокупности тегов.
Управление с оттенками, шрифтами и полями
Цветовое дизайн формирует визуальную атмосферу веб-страницы. Свойство color меняет цвет текста. Параметр background-color устанавливает фон элемента. Цвета записываются несколькими вариантами: именами, шестнадцатеричными записями или параметрами RGB.
Шестнадцатеричный тип открывается с символа диеза. Код состоит из шести символов, определяющих красный, зелёный и синий каналы. Вид RGB использует цифровые значения от 0 до 255 для каждого канала. Формат RGBA вносит свойство прозрачности.
Типографика сказывается на удобочитаемость содержимого. Свойство font-family задаёт тип шрифта. Параметр font-size определяет размер надписи. Атрибут font-weight управляет толщину начертания. Параметр line-height определяет межстрочный интервал.
Встроенные гарнитуры имеются на всех устройствах. Веб-шрифты загружаются с удалённых хостов. Платформа Google Fonts предоставляет свободную подборку шрифтов. Разработчики указывают несколько гарнитур в очерёдности приоритета.
Отступы генерируют место вокруг компонентов. Параметр margin создаёт наружные интервалы между блоками. Параметр padding создаёт внутренние отступы от границ до контента. Интервалы можно задавать для каждой стороны индивидуально или одним числом единовременно для всех сторон. Корректное использование 7k casino усиливает графическую структуру и усвоение информации.
Блочная схема и расположение блоков
Блочная схема характеризует структуру каждого HTML-элемента. Схема складывается из четырёх секций: содержимого, внутреннего интервала, рамки и внешнего интервала. Понимание этой идеи требуется для корректного регулирования размерами.
Область содержимого включает текст и изображения. Внутренний отступ padding создаёт пространство между контентом и краем. Обводка border очерчивает блок заметной чертой. Наружный поле margin формирует промежуток до соседних контейнеров.
Параметр box-sizing меняет расчёт габаритов. Значение content-box учитывает только содержимое. Вариант border-box включает padding и border в итоговую размер.
Параметр display устанавливает режим отображения. Блочные компоненты занимают всю свободную ширину. Строчные блоки находятся в одной линии. Параметр inline-block совмещает свойства обоих видов.
Атрибут position регулирует расположением. Значение relative сдвигает элемент относительно первоначального места. Absolute располагает блок относительно вышестоящего контейнера. Актуальный 7К казино использует Flexbox и Grid для построения комплексных структур.
Гибкая верстка для разных аппаратов
Адаптивная вёрстка гарантирует правильное отображение сайта на всех мониторах. Пользователи открывают на веб-страницы с десктопов, планшетов и мобильных устройств. Макет обязан настраиваться под габарит монитора автоматически.
Медиазапросы применяют стили в соответствии от характеристик устройства. Правило @media анализирует ширину экрана и прочие параметры. Специалисты генерируют самостоятельные наборы стилей для различных диапазонов габаритов.
Принцип mobile-first стартует проектирование с редакции для мобильных устройств. Начальные стили задают стилизацию для небольших мониторов. Медиазапросы вносят расширения для крупных дисплеев.
Адаптивные макеты применяют пропорциональные меры измерения. Ширина блоков устанавливается в процентах вместо фиксированных пикселей. Flexbox и Grid создают адаптивные компоновки без комплексных вычислений.
Картинки нуждаются специального внимания при оптимизации. Параметр max-width со параметром 100% блокирует вылет картинок за пределы блока. Атрибут srcset скачивает изображения различного разрешения. Правильная реализация 7k casino повышает пользовательский впечатление на всех видах аппаратов.
Типичные промахи новичков при разработке с HTML и CSS
Стартующие разработчики допускают распространённые ошибки при разработке страниц. Понимание распространённых проблем позволяет предотвратить их в собственных разработках. Коррекция ошибок на начальных стадиях сохраняет время и улучшает стандарт программы.
Главные промахи при взаимодействии с структурой и стилями:
- Незакрытые теги разрушают архитектуру страницы и ведут к некорректному отображению
- Использование устаревших меток вместо новых смысловых компонентов
- Недостаток описательного текста для изображений снижает доступность контента
- Встроенные стили в HTML осложняют сопровождение и модификацию стилизации
- Неправильная вложенность компонентов создаёт конфликты в архитектуре
- Чрезмерное использование идентификаторов вместо классов ограничивает многократное использование стилей
Недочёты с CSS также наблюдаются регулярно. Начинающие упускают задавать меры измерения для числовых параметров. Чрезмерно конкретные селекторы усложняют изменение стилей. Отсутствие сброса стилей браузера порождает отличия в представлении на разнообразных платформах.
Игнорирование кроссбраузерной согласованности вызывает к проблемам. Страница может прекрасно выглядеть в одном браузере и неправильно в другом. Проверка кода через особые платформы выявляет синтаксические недочёты. Регулярная верификация позволяет казино 7к обеспечивать высокое стандарт разработки и соблюдение требованиям.